Covered in detail in the book _The Busy Coder's Guide to Android Development_ https://commonsware.com/Android */ package com.commonsware.android.exif; import android.app.Activity; import android.content.Context; import android.content.res.AssetManager; import android.graphics.Bitmap; import android.graphics.BitmapFactory; import android.graphics.Matrix; import android.media.MediaScannerConnection; import android.os.Bundle; import android.util.Log; import android.widget.ImageView; import org.greenrobot.eventbus.EventBus; import org.greenrobot.eventbus.Subscribe; import org.greenrobot.eventbus.ThreadMode; import java.io.File; import java.io.InputStream; import it.sephiroth.android.library.exif2.ExifInterface; import it.sephiroth.android.library.exif2.ExifTag; public class MainActivity extends Activity { private static final String ASSET_NAME="Landscape_8.jpg"; private ImageView original; private ImageView oriented; @Override protected void onCreate(Bundle savedInstanceState) { super.onCreate(savedInstanceState); setContentView(R.layout.activity_main); original=(ImageView)findViewById(R.id.original_image); oriented=(ImageView)findViewById(R.id.oriented_image); new ImageLoadThread(this).start(); } @Override protected void onStart() { super.onStart(); EventBus.getDefault().register(this); } @Override protected void onStop() { EventBus.getDefault().unregister(this); super.onStop(); } @Subscribe(sticky=true, threadMode=ThreadMode.MAIN) public void onImageLoaded(ImageLoadedEvent event) { original.setImageBitmap(event.original); if (BuildConfig.ROTATE_BITMAP) { oriented.setImageBitmap(event.rotated); } else { oriented.setImageBitmap(event.original); oriented.setRotation(degreesForRotation(event.orientation)); } } private static class ImageLoadThread extends Thread { private final Context ctxt; ImageLoadThread(Context ctxt) { this.ctxt=ctxt.getApplicationContext(); } @Override public void run() { AssetManager assets=ctxt.getAssets(); try { InputStream is=assets.open(ASSET_NAME); ExifInterface exif=new ExifInterface(); exif.readExif(is, ExifInterface.Options.OPTION_ALL); ExifTag tag=exif.getTag(ExifInterface.TAG_ORIENTATION); int orientation=(tag==null ? -1 : tag.getValueAsInt(-1)); if (orientation==8 || orientation==3 || orientation==6) { is=assets.open(ASSET_NAME); Bitmap original=BitmapFactory.decodeStream(is); Bitmap rotated=null; if (BuildConfig.ROTATE_BITMAP) { rotated=rotateViaMatrix(original, orientation); exif.setTagValue(ExifInterface.TAG_ORIENTATION, 1); exif.removeCompressedThumbnail(); File output= new File(ctxt.getExternalFilesDir(null), "rotated.jpg"); exif.writeExif(rotated, output.getAbsolutePath(), 100); MediaScannerConnection.scanFile(ctxt, new String[]{output.getAbsolutePath()}, null, null); } EventBus .getDefault() .postSticky(new ImageLoadedEvent(original, rotated, orientation)); } } catch (Exception e) { Log.e(getClass().getSimpleName(), "Exception processing image", e); } } } static private Bitmap rotateViaMatrix(Bitmap original, int orientation) { Matrix matrix=new Matrix(); matrix.setRotate(degreesForRotation(orientation)); return(Bitmap.createBitmap(original, 0, 0, original.getWidth(), original.getHeight(), matrix, true)); } static private int degreesForRotation(int orientation) { int result; switch (orientation) { case 8: result=270; break; case 3: result=180; break; default: result=90; } return(result); } private static class ImageLoadedEvent { final Bitmap original; final Bitmap rotated; final int orientation; ImageLoadedEvent(Bitmap original, Bitmap rotated, int orientation) { this.original=original; this.rotated=rotated; this.orientation=orientation; } } }
